The recent announcement regarding Huawei’s collaboration with Yunnan Power Grid Co., Ltd. to construct a next-generation high-speed bearer network underscores a significant strategic development in the energy sector within Southwest China. This initiative is particularly timely given the ongoing global transition toward sustainable energy sources and the increasing demand for efficient energy management solutions. Yunnan, known for its abundant renewable energy resources, faces unique challenges due to its diverse topography and extensive distances across which energy must be transmitted.
The deployment of Huawei’s SPN (Service Provider Network) technology represents a crucial advancement in addressing these challenges. By enhancing the communication infrastructure that supports Yunnan’s power grid, this initiative aims to optimize the integration and management of renewable energy sources such as hydro, wind, and solar power. The high-speed bearer network is designed to facilitate real-time data transmission between various grid components, essential for the effective operation of smart grids. This capability will allow for advanced monitoring and management features, ultimately leading to increased reliability and efficiency in energy distribution.
Moreover, the project aligns seamlessly with China’s broader energy policies, as outlined in recent governmental directives that emphasize the scale-up of clean energy use and the establishment of smart grids across the nation. By incorporating cutting-edge communication technologies, Yunnan Power Grid is positioned to not only enhance operational resilience but also to contribute to China’s climate goals by enabling a more robust framework for renewable energy integration. This advancement will likely fortify Yunnan’s status as a pivotal player in the regional energy landscape.
